Carrot Ginger Sauce

Carrot Ginger Sauce is the pasta addition you didn’t know you were looking for — creamy, flavorful, and packed with nourishing ingredients. And it’s not just for pasta! This vibrant sauce is delicious tossed with rice, spooned over roasted vegetables, or even spread inside wraps and bowls.

When it comes to my kids, they usually don’t care what’s mixed into their pasta or rice — as long as it tastes good. But the first time I served this bright “orange pasta,” they were definitely skeptical. One bite later? Completely hooked.

The natural sweetness from the carrots, the savory depth of miso, and the nutty richness of tahini create a flavor combination that’s comforting, unique, and surprisingly kid-approved.

  1. Start by prepping your vegetables. Peel and mince the garlic and ginger, and peel and finely chop the carrots.
  2. Heat oil in a sauté pan over medium heat and add the garlic. Cook until fragrant and softened, about 30 seconds. Add the ginger and carrots, cover, and cook until the carrots are tender — about 15 minutes.
  3. Transfer everything to a food processor. Add the tahini and miso, then puree until completely smooth and creamy.
  4. Toss with your family’s favorite pasta and serve immediately.
